Analysis

Kyrgyzstan recorded 3.92 preT for average per capita transfer held by 2nd quintile - international in 2020.

That represents a change of down 17.6% on the previous year and up 35.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, average per capita transfer held by 2nd quintile - international in Kyrgyzstan peaked at 5.9 preT in 2015 and was at its lowest, 2.26 preT, in 2012.

That places Kyrgyzstan 7th out of 27 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.
